Window relative tilda что значит

Window relative tilda — это один из важных CSS-селекторов, который позволяет выбирать элементы, относительно позиции окна браузера. Он позволяет управлять стилями элементов на основе их относительного положения на странице.

Основное применение window relative tilda в CSS заключается в том, чтобы изменять стили элементов на основе их положения на экране пользователя. Например, можно задать другой фоновый цвет или шрифт для элементов, которые находятся в видимой области окна браузера, и для элементов, которые находятся за его пределами.

Для использования window relative tilda в CSS, нужно использовать символ тильда (~) и указать селектор, который будет применяться к элементам, находящимся в заданной позиции окна браузера. Например, если нужно выбрать все элементы, которые находятся после определенного элемента на странице, можно использовать следующий синтаксис: element ~ selector.

Например, если у нас есть следующий HTML-код:

<div class="first">Первый</div>

<div class="second">Второй</div>

<div class="third">Третий</div>

Для выбора всех элементов, которые находятся после элемента с классом «first», можно использовать следующий CSS-селектор: .first ~ div. Таким образом, будут выбраны все элементы с классом «second» и «third».

Определение window relative tilda

Window relative tilda — это технология, которая позволяет создавать окна на веб-страницах, которые отображаются относительно положения указателя мыши. Тильда («~») здесь обозначает символ, который обычно используется для обозначения окна на веб-странице.

Окна, создаваемые с использованием window relative tilda, отображаются над основным контентом страницы и могут содержать различные элементы, такие как текст, изображения или даже видео. Их позиция и размер автоматически рассчитываются в соответствии с положением указателя мыши.

Window relative tilda обеспечивает пользователю более удобный способ взаимодействия с контентом на веб-странице. Он позволяет отобразить дополнительную информацию или функциональность, связанную с определенным элементом, при наведении указателя мыши на него.

Преимущества использования window relative tilda:

  • Улучшенная пользовательская навигация и взаимодействие
  • Более удобный доступ к дополнительной информации
  • Возможность предоставления контекстной помощи или подробного описания элементов
  • Улучшенный дизайн и визуальные эффекты

Пример использования window relative tilda:

Элемент Окно с подробностями
Товар 1 Окно с описанием и изображением товара 1
Товар 2 Окно с описанием и изображением товара 2
Товар 3 Окно с описанием и изображением товара 3

В данном примере, при наведении указателя мыши на название товара, отображается окно с подробностями, которое перемещается вместе с указателем мыши. Пользователь может легко получить дополнительную информацию о товаре без необходимости покидать страницу.

Какой смысл имеет window relative tilda?

Window relative tilda — это особенность языка CSS, которая позволяет указывать относительные размеры элементов относительно размеров окна браузера.

Основное предназначение window relative tilda заключается в том, чтобы создавать адаптивные элементы, которые масштабируются в зависимости от размеров окна браузера. С помощью window relative tilda можно задать относительные размеры элементов, чтобы они автоматически подстраивались под разные устройства и разрешения экрана.

Window relative tilda применяется для указания размеров элементов с использованием относительных значений, таких как проценты или максимальные ширины и высоты. Например, можно задать width элемента в процентах от ширины окна браузера с помощью следующего кода:

.element {
width: 50%;
}

Таким образом, при изменении размеров окна браузера, ширина элемента будет автоматически изменяться, чтобы оставаться равной 50% ширины окна.

Window relative tilda также может использоваться совместно с другими свойствами CSS, такими как min-width и max-width, чтобы задать диапазон размеров элемента, которые они могут занимать.

Преимуществом использования window relative tilda является то, что она позволяет создавать адаптивные и отзывчивые дизайны, которые могут легко адаптироваться к разным размерам окна браузера и устройствам.

Однако следует помнить, что window relative tilda может быть не поддерживаема некоторыми старыми версиями браузеров или устройствами с маленькими экранами, поэтому при его использовании необходимо учитывать возможные ограничения.

Примеры использования window relative tilda

Window relative tilda — это специальный символ ~, который используется в контексте пути к файлам и папкам. Он позволяет указывать относительный путь от корневой директории (обычно домашней директории пользователя).

Вот несколько примеров использования window relative tilda:

Пример 1: Путь к домашней директории

Предположим, что ваше имя пользователя в системе Windows — «username». Вы можете использовать window relative tilda, чтобы указать путь к вашей домашней директории:

const homeDirectory = '~/Documents';
console.log(homeDirectory); // C:ame\Documents

В этом примере window relative tilda (~) заменяет путь к домашней директории пользователя «username».

Пример 2: Импорт модулей

Window relative tilda также может использоваться для импорта модулей, особенно если они находятся в директории выше текущей директории:

// Предположим, что файл module.js находится в директории выше текущей директории
import module from '~/module.js';

В этом примере window relative tilda (~) указывает на директорию выше текущей директории, где находится файл module.js.

Пример 3: Использование с функцией require

Если вы используете встроенную функцию require для импорта модулей, вы также можете использовать window relative tilda:

const module = require('~/module.js');

В этом примере window relative tilda (~) указывает на директорию выше текущей директории, где находится файл module.js.

Window relative tilda — это мощный инструмент для работы с относительными путями в Windows. Он позволяет удобно указывать путь к домашней директории пользователя и облегчает импорт модулей из директорий выше текущей.

Оцените статью
Обучающие статьи